Role Summary:

Penta’s Intelligence division is hiring interns to support our next-generation news monitoring service that uses both professionals, and technology, to support our clients. This service is designed to inform the decision-making cycle for media engagement and improve planning, feedback, and reporting for public affairs and communications teams. Owned by our Global Monitoring team, the service delivers real-time alerts directly into the inboxes of those engaging and responding to the media every day.

Interns will work with our dedicated media analysts and be trained in the latest media aggregation tools while conducting hands-on analysis to deliver the news and insights clients need to make more informed decisions. This full-time, paid internship, is a fantastic opportunity for candidates interested in media research, insights, and analytics to build foundational skills that will set them up for a successful future career in media relations.

This role is expected to:

- Monitor news and events across outlets and platforms, including print, digital, television, radio, and social media

- Collaborate with a team of analysts to alert the news to clients in a timely and effective manner

- Collect and prepare data to support media analysis

- Assist with long-term research projects

Compensation:

This is a non-exempt position eligible for overtime. The hourly pay for this internship will be $20 per hour. Any pre-approved hours worked over 40 hours per week will be paid at time and a half.

Location, Work Hours, and Remote Schedule:

For this position, we are only considering applicants located in the US state of Hawaii who are able to work remotely 40 hours per week during a morning shift (8 am - 4 pm HST). The duration of this internship is 6 months with an anticipated start date of early-June 2025.
